Bike & Bean Train Gang Gravel Social Ride - July 10th

Who’s up for gravel riding? Jump onboard with the Train Gang on Thursday evenings for beginner/intermediate level rides in the St. Margaret’s Bay Area. These social rides are a terrific opportunity to meet other riders and have fun. If you don’t have a gravel bike your mountain bike will do fine. These are no-drop rides with an average distance of 20 – 30 km with a goal pace of 20km/h. We’ll regroup at the top of each major climb. Riders should be comfortable with loose climbs and descents. Meet-up at the Train Station Bike and Bean in Upper Tantallon. The group departs at 6:30 PM with return planned for no later than 8:30 PM.

Where: Departs the Train Station Bike & Bean in Upper Tantallon at 6;30 PM. Parking is available at the shop or in the nearby lot at Redmond’s Home Hardware.

Difficulty: This is a no-drop group ride. Our goal pace is 20 km/h. We’ll regroup at the top of all major climbs. Nobody will be left behind.

Route: Bay Lookout Ramble

Notes: A Cycling Nova Scotia membership is required. This is a self-supported group ride, please carry any water/nutrition and spares you might need to repair your bike on the ride. The club requires a bell for the SMB trail portions, and a red rear light for the road portions. Bug spray is never a bad idea.
